6 Signs Your Business's Flat Roof Needs Repair

Jan 30, 2024

A commercial flat roof is a durable and functional roofing system built to withstand weather extremes and heavy foot traffic. However, like all roofing systems, flat roofs eventually deteriorate. If your commercial flat roof becomes damaged or leaks, it poses significant risks to your business's safety, structure, and profitability. Therefore, it's essential to know when your flat roof requires repair, maintenance, or a complete replacement.


In this blog post, we'll outline the six signs your business flat roof needs repair.


Cracks in the Roof


Flat roofs are prone to developing cracks due to increased exposure to harsh weather elements, debris, and aging. When cracks appear on your roof, water seeps through the gaps, causing extensive water damage to your structure's walls, floors, and electrical systems.


If you notice cracks appear on your flat roof, reach out to a professional roofing contractor immediately. They will evaluate the extent of damage and recommend the best repair options.


Blistering and Bubbling


When your flat roof develops blisters and bubbles, you need to take action immediately. Blistering and bubbling occur when moisture gets trapped under the roofing membrane, causing it to lift or bubble. Often, this results from inadequate ventilation or poor roofing installation. Don't ignore these signs, as they can cause significant water damage to your roofing system and harm your building's structural integrity.


Standing Water on Your Flat Roof


Flat roofs are built to drain water efficiently, and standing water is a concerning sign that your flat roof needs repair. Standing water is caused by clogged gutters, blocked drainage systems, or improper slopes. Prolonged exposure to standing water can cause leaks and structural damage, and affect your building's foundation. If you notice standing water on your flat roof, don't hesitate to contact a roofing professional for repairs.


Poor Insulation and Energy Efficiency


A flat roof with poor insulation and energy efficiency can cost you in the long run. Higher energy bills and inadequate temperature regulation affect your building's comfort, drain resources, and damage your business's profitability. It's essential to inspect your roof's insulation and ensure there is no heat loss. If your flat roof insulation requires repair, reach out to a roofing contractor for expert services.


Odors and Poor Indoor Air Quality


Odors originating from your flat roof signify a severe roofing problem and can significantly affect your business's indoor air quality. Day-to-day operations can produce harmful chemicals like formaldehyde, carbon monoxide, and other fumes that add to the mix of flat roof odors.


Odors from your flat roofs can lead to respiratory problems, headaches, and other health-related issues. A roofing contractor will identify any roofing faults and ensure your roofing system vents out air effectively.


Age of Your Flat Roof


Often, the age of your flat roof will determine when you will require roof repairs or replacement. Flat roofs have a lifespan of a couple of decades, after which they begin deteriorating. However, prolonged exposure to harsh weather and inadequate maintenance can lead to the need for repairs before the roof's end of life.


A roofing expert can evaluate your flat roof condition and recommend the best option for your business.


A damaged or leaking commercial flat roof poses a significant risk to your business structure and safety and costs you money in the long run. Regular roof repair and maintenance are essential to prolonging your flat roof's life span and ensuring your business's profitability.
